Time & Perspective Quote by Pierce Brosnan

"I had to have some balls to be Irish Catholic in South London. Most of that time I spent fighting"

About this Quote

There’s a deliberate roughness to Brosnan’s line, the kind that refuses the polished “origin story” you’d expect from a future Bond. “Some balls” is doing double duty: it’s macho vernacular, sure, but it’s also a marker of class and neighborhood speech, a way of keeping the memory unvarnished. He’s not glamorizing hardship; he’s signaling the social cost of standing out.

The cultural context matters. Irish Catholic identity in postwar London carried baggage: outsider status, old prejudices, and the low-level sectarian edge that could turn schoolyards and streets into proving grounds. By specifying “South London,” Brosnan points to a geography of toughness and tribalism, where belonging is policed in accents and last names as much as in fists. The line compresses that ambient hostility into a blunt equation: visibility equals vulnerability.

“Most of that time I spent fighting” lands less as brag than as a grim tally. It suggests a childhood organized around defense, where violence becomes routine rather than exceptional. That subtext reframes resilience as something learned under pressure, not curated later for interviews. It also quietly complicates Brosnan’s later screen persona. Bond is all composure, tailored control, effortless charm; this is the prequel where the performance of confidence is forged because it has to be. The intent reads as reclamation: a reminder that behind the suave public image sits a background shaped by the raw politics of identity and place.
